In recent decades, authors affiliated with Pacific University Oregon have published 1.6k papers, which have received a total of 26.3k indexed citations. Scholars at this organization have produced 283 papers in Clinical Psychology, 176 papers in Epidemiology and 175 papers in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health on the topics of Ophthalmology and Visual Impairment Studies (79 papers), Mindfulness and Compassion Interventions (79 papers) and Child and Adolescent Psychosocial and Emotional Development (58 papers). Their work is cited by papers focused on Clinical Psychology (4.4k citations),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health (3.0k citations) and Epidemiology (2.9k citations). Authors at Pacific University Oregon collaborate with scholars in United States, India and Canada and have published in prestigious journals including Science,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ences and Advanced Materials. Some of Pacific University Oregon's most productive authors include Jeffrey Barlow, Steven B. Johnson, Jules Boykoff, Michael Christopher, Maxwell Boykoff, Fawzy Elbarbry, Keith H. Basso, Sarah Johnson, Sarah Bowen and James E. Sheedy.

Rankless uses publication and citation data sourced from OpenAlex, an open and comprehensive bibliographic database. While OpenAlex provides broad and valuable coverage of the global research landscape, it—like all bibliographic datasets—has inherent limitations. These include incomplete records, variations in author disambiguation, differences in journal indexing, and delays in data updates. As a result, some metrics and network relationships displayed in Rankless may not fully capture the entirety of a scholar’s output or impact.
